Real-Time Prediction of Alzheimer's Disease Progression Using Multimodal Clinical Data
NeuroCast is an advanced multimodal deep learning system developed to address the critical challenge of managing Alzheimer's disease. The platform predicts the progression of the disease—specifically forecasting the Delta MMSE (Mini-Mental State Examination) score—to indicate cognitive decline or stability over time.
Unlike standard clinical assessments, NeuroCast fuses diverse clinical and genetic biomarkers through a sophisticated deep learning architecture to provide neurologists with personalized progression trajectories.
- Multimodal Fusion Architecture: Integrates diverse datasets including patient demographics (age, gender, education) and specific gene expressions (AQP7, RPS5, CHD2, SNX5, ASS1).
- Advanced Deep Learning Models: Utilizes a combination of CNN and LSTM networks to process complex longitudinal data, optimized with custom loss functions and rigorous dataset merging using Pandas.
- Clinical Dashboard: A responsive, real-time interface for doctors to input patient visit data, track historical MMSE scores, and generate AI-driven clinical trends.
- Delta Prediction: Focuses on predicting the change in cognitive capability (Delta MMSE), providing a clear clinical trend rather than just a static diagnostic classification.
- Seamless API Integration: Connects the interactive Next.js frontend to a dedicated AI backend for real-time inference and database syncing via Prisma.
Frontend & Dashboard:
- Framework: Next.js (React)
- Language: TypeScript
- Styling: Tailwind CSS
- Database ORM: Prisma
AI & Data Science Backend:
- Architecture: Multimodal Deep Learning (CNN & LSTM)
- Data Processing: Python & Pandas
- API: RESTful architecture for model inference
